Code P1559 Buick Description
The P1559 Buick code refers to Cruise Control Power Management Mode. In vehicles equipped with cruise control, this code indicates a problem with the system's power management mode. The power management mode helps regulate the cruise control system's power consumption and efficiency, ensuring it operates effectively while minimizing unnecessary power usage.
Common Causes of P1559 Buick
- Faulty cruise control switch
- Damaged wiring or connectors in the cruise control system
- Malfunctioning cruise control module
- Issues with the vehicle's engine control module (ECM)
- Electrical problems in the vehicle's system
Symptoms of P1559 Buick
- Cruise control fails to engage
- Cruise control disengages unexpectedly
- Inability to maintain set speed
- Illumination of the check engine light
- Reduced fuel efficiency on long trips
How to Fix P1559 Buick
- Begin by diagnosing the specific cause of the P1559 code using a diagnostic scanner.
- Inspect the cruise control system components, including the switch, wiring, and control module, for any visible damage or malfunctions.
- Test the functionality of the cruise control system to determine if any components need to be replaced.
- Repair or replace faulty components such as the cruise control switch, wiring, or control module as needed.
- Clear the diagnostic trouble codes from the vehicle's ECM and test the cruise control system to ensure it is operating correctly.
Cost to Fix P1559 Buick
The cost of repairing the P1559 Buick code can vary depending on the specific cause of the issue and the labor rates in your area. On average, the repair cost for addressing cruise control issues can range from $100 to $500. This estimate includes the cost of parts such as a new cruise control switch or module, as well as labor charges for diagnosing and repairing the problem. Keep in mind that labor rates at auto repair shops can vary, so it's best to obtain a detailed quote from a trusted mechanic before proceeding with the repair.
